This section provides an overview of the explorable areas in Persona 3 FES, focusing on Gekkoukan High School and Tatsumi Port Island.

Gekkoukan High School

  1. School Entranceway: A long pathway with opportunities for conversations and triggered events.
  2. First Floor
    • Main Lobby: Features bulletin boards for school information and a vendor for food.
    • Faculty Hallway: Contains the Faculty Office, Nurse Office (Infirmary), and Library. One Link can be activated here.
    • Culture Clubs: Houses the Music Club, Art Room, Home Economics Room, Science Room, and Laboratory. The first four are Link locations; the lab is for a Request. Two Links can be activated here.
    • Janitor Room: Typically locked, but accessible later for story progression.
    • Culture-Athletic Corridor: A location for a Request.
    • Athletic Department: Offers the Kendo Club, Track Field (Practice Field), and Swimming Club (Indoor Swimming Club). One Link can be activated here.
  3. Second Floor
    • Hallway: Five Links can be activated here.
    • Student Council Room: One Link can be activated here.
    • Homeroom: Includes classrooms 2-E and 2-F. 2-E has one SEES member. 2-F has three SEES members and three Links can be activated here.
    • PA Room: Used for Requests.
    • Emergency Exit: No special features noted.
  4. Rooftop: A frequent location for events and Links, and one Request.

Tatsumi Port Island

  1. Gekkoukan High School: Refer to the section above.
  2. Paulownia Mall: Features Escapade (one Link), Chagall Cafe (Charm increase), Be blue V (accessories), police station (weapons/armor), Mandragora Karaoke (Courage increase), Shinshoudo Antiques (gem trading for items/cards), Aohige Pharmacy (healing items), and Game Panics (stat increases). . The Velvet Room is accessible via a path with velvet light. Power Records has no listed use.
  3. Port Island Station: Includes Rafflesia Florist (flowers), Screen Shot Movie Theater (stat raising), an outskirt area with punks, Akataka Mahjong, and Shot-Bar Que Sera Sera. Some Requests can be completed here.
  4. Iwatodai Station: Comprises the station, Iwatodai Strip Mall (with facilities), and the surrounding area. . The strip mall includes Bookworms (used books), Wild-duck Burger (Courage increase), Octopia vendor (takoyaki), Sweet Shop (no purpose listed), Hagakure Ramen (Charm increase), Wakatsu Restaurant (Academics increase), Book On (manga reading), and Beef Bowl Shop.
  5. Naganaki Shrine: . Inari Sushi offers random effects (e.g., increased EXP/money in Tartarus, reduced TIRED chance, Soma/Bead Chains, stat boosts). The offertory box increases Academics. Fortune can be drawn to improve relationships.
